Abstract
The combination of climate change and invasive species could be devastating for some native plants and animals as well as for food security, international trade and other economic activities in the Pacific. An IUCN report listed invasive species as the most important direct pressure on the environment in Oceania and stated “poor understanding of environmental problems or their root causes” was the most important barrier to addressing pressures on the environment.
